Hi guys i would like to ask how do we save a special character into mysql. Download this app from microsoft store for windows 10, windows 10 mobile, windows 10 team surface hub, hololens, xbox one. Php storing utf8 characters properly in mysql database. And restore mysql databases with special characters using mysqldumper. Executing this function without a mysql connection present will also emit. Storing special characters internationalization in mysql. How to store special character mathamatical symbols in. How special characters are inserted into mysql database. How to store text in multiple languages in sql server. The convert function converts a string into a specific character set. The chars work fine on the website and are stored in a utf8mb4 database. It soon became apparent that there were problems with the stored data. Are you using mysqls utf8 charset in your databases. If you want to store characters from multiple languages in a single column, you can use.
How to save special character in mysql codeproject. Greeting, i have an issue regarding inserting special characters in the database. In this quick tutorial im going to show you how to save special characters in a mysql database. Unfortunately when the data was retrieved, there was an encoding problem. Is there any way, oracle will allow to store special characters to do the job simpler. I want to store special charaters mathamatical operators and scientific notation charater like. Specify utf8 as the encoding in all calls to htmlspecialchars. If i define the column as clob, then i can put text which even contains special characters with out much effort. Problem inserting special characters in mysql database. Special characters doesnt display in phpsql php the. When receiving emails with words that contain an apostrophe such as ladys the apostrophe is replaced with special characters, for. Mysql receives the data as latin1, converts it internally to utf8 and stores it.
It soon became apparent that there were problems with the stored data, as sometimes the data. Also im using jsp, springmvc and hibernate in my application for windows platform window xp and later version. Im having a small problem with storage of special characters like quotes, double quotes and ampersands. A string is a sequence of letters, numbers, special characters and arithmetic values or. You could also escape the unicode symbols into some sort of sanitized. Can anyone explain, how i can escape wildcard chars like % in the mysql like. The character im trying to insert is sign for euro currency. Also include your database configuration file on the new file that you created. Utf8 is a variablewidth encoding that can represent every character in the unicode. In this tutorial you will learn how to store and manipulate strings in php. You can still store utf8 multibyte characters in a latin1 or ascii text column most of the time for example, if you store a 2byte utf8 character it will be visible in the database as two.
The umlaut problem how to successfully back up and restore. Escaping wildcard characters like % in mysql like statement. Nvachar, nchar, ntext are the datatypes in sql server that can be used for storing nonenglish characters. Otherwise, any special characters in these files may not be handled correctly. Mysql character set an introduction to character sets in mysql. Correct php method to store special chars in mysql db stack. However, if a utf8 string contains special character e. If i create a stored procedure in my mysql db the procedure will receive. If by special character you mean since php helps in inserting words into db but does not give the same result with try using. To insert binary data into a string column such as a blob column, you should represent certain characters. First, setup a testing folder then create a new php file. How to store and retrieve special characters on mysql.
682 755 546 863 1108 639 1241 694 1532 781 1035 419 839 202 167 879 152 809 284 145 294 746 24 980 779 452 1332 430 497 864 1460 378 305 1417 66 1362 166 1109 738 349